Solution for 3y+5x=5 equation:


Simplifying
3y + 5x = 5

Reorder the terms:
5x + 3y = 5

Solving
5x + 3y = 5

Solving for variable 'x'.

Move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right.

Add '-3y' to each side of the equation.
5x + 3y + -3y = 5 + -3y

Combine like terms: 3y + -3y = 0
5x + 0 = 5 + -3y
5x = 5 + -3y

Divide each side by '5'.
x = 1 + -0.6y

Simplifying
x = 1 + -0.6y
